Abstract

Cyclic amidinium containing compounds and their methods of preparation are described. Compositions containing these compounds facilitate delivery of biologically active polymers to cells in vitro and in vivo.

Claims (14)

1. A process for delivering a polynucleotide to a cell comprising: associating a cationic poly cyclic imidazolinium-containing compound capable of condensing nucleic acid with the polynucleotide to form a complex and contacting the cell with the complex.

2. The process of claim 1 wherein the polynucleotide consists of DNA.

3. The process of claim 1 wherein the polynucleotide consists of RNA.

4. The process of claim 1 wherein the polynucleotide consists of an siRNA.

5. The process of claim 1 wherein the poly cyclic imidazolinium consists of a partially acylated polyethylenimine.

6. The process of claim 5 wherein the partially acylated polyethylenimine consists of an N-propionyl polyethylenimine derivative.

7. The process of claim 5 wherein the polyethylenimine consists of linear polyethylenimine.

8. The process of claim 1 wherein the poly cyclic imidazolinium consists of partially acylated polyallylamine.

9. The process of claim 1 wherein the poly cyclic imidazolinium consists of partially acylated polyvinylamine.

10. The process of claim 1 wherein the cell consists of an in vivo cell.

11. The process of claim 10 wherein the in vivo cell consists of a lung cell.

12. The process of claim 10 wherein the in vivo cell consists of a liver cell.

13. The process of claim 12 wherein the liver cell consists of a hepatocyte.

14. The process of claim 1 further comprising: associating a polyanion with the complex to form a ternary complex having a negative ζ-potential.
